What Is a Mouse Trap Car?
Understanding the Context
A mouse trap car is a classic physics and engineering experiment where a small model vehicle is powered by the rapid release of energy from a baited trap, typically using a small mousetrap spring mechanism. While traditionally built for cleverness and fun, modern iterations are pushing boundaries—emphasizing speed, performance, and precision.

How It Works—The Science Behind the Speed
When pulled back, the mousetrap stores elastic potential energy. At the perfect moment, this energy propels the car forward in a controlled burst. Smart builders enhance this by fine-tuning the release angle, improving gear ratios, and securing a rigid frame—turning simple spring power into kinetic energy that cranks the vehicle forward with blistering acceleration.
Why Build a Mouse Trap Car?
Beyond the excitement and novelty, building this device teaches valuable STEM skills:
- Understanding energy transfer and mechanical advantage
- Problem solving through iterative design and testing
- Hands-on experience with physics principles like force, motion, and friction
- Creative innovation within a minimalist constraint
